Transaction 369e1d4c66d5a5a539c4e07629063083ac537ca8f5d6a4f9195b64fb1a0b26e2
1 Input
1 Output
-
369e1d4c66d5a5a539c4e07629063083ac537ca8f5d6a4f9195b64fb1a0b26e2:0
- value
- 31359413
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 566a6d55891bb9bab03a3187ea6ace1de962058d OP_EQUAL
- address
- 39ZwXizPLaPUGZe17tgkhY2RWxrpKaoJJF